Stability

Stable, but pyrophoric - spontaneously inflammable in air. Incompatible with oxidizing agents. Moisture sensitive.

Sensitiveness

Moisture Sensitive/Air Sensitive

FAQ

What is Tributyl Phosphine (CAS: 998-40-3)?

Tributyl phosphine, with the CAS number 998-40-3, is an organophosphorus compound with the chemical formula C12H27P. It is a colorless liquid with a mild odor and is commonly used as a phosphine donor in chemical reactions. Tributyl phosphine is known for its stability under normal conditions and its ability to act as a reducing agent in various synthetic processes.

What are the main uses of Tributyl Phosphine (CAS: 998-40-3)?

Tributyl phosphine is widely utilized in pharmaceuticals, organic synthesis, and industrial chemistry. It serves as a key reagent in coupling reactions, catalytic processes, and as a ligand in transition metal complexes. Additionally, it finds applications in the production of pesticides, flame retardants, and specialty chemicals. Its role in research settings is significant for developing new materials and compounds.
